Comparison Analysis

Eureka College and the University of Mount Olive have similar earnings. Eureka College graduates earn $42,968, while University of Mount Olive graduates earn $43,026. However, Eureka College has a higher tuition cost, at $28,400, compared to the University of Mount Olive's $25,950. Both schools have similar graduation rates, with Eureka College at 48.3% and the University of Mount Olive at 48.1%.

Eureka College has a higher acceptance rate of 88.5% compared to the University of Mount Olive's 77.8%.

Based on these metrics, the University of Mount Olive offers a slightly better value proposition due to its lower tuition cost and similar earnings and graduation rates. However, Eureka College may be easier to get into due to its higher acceptance rate.
